My words and my thoughts equal emotions!

Every time I wrote a poem, these three words were in my equation. I started writing poems in high school after finding a poetry book buried in a dresser drawer in my grandmother's home. The impact and emotions covered my body, and I wanted others to feel that same emotion through my words. This time it will be my vision and my writings!

This journey started just like that buried poetry book. Instead of a book, there were buried relationships that would soon to be discovered. Those relationships of others impacted my emotions, therefore my writings. Some relationships were stronger than others and captured stronger emotions; those stories were easy to convey. I have left out names, a place, or race and revealed a story in a general aspect.

Overall, this book is a passionate journey through the beauty of relationships, love, pain, and most importantly, a reflection of all. We all have a story that we want to share through some form of art. In this book I hope to capture words, thoughts, and emotions that will share a message through my life experiences. In the end of it all, steal your hearts with words.
